Shortages of the Metro Cars are often seen with peak time extras unable to run which does mean that some of the unrefurbished vehicles are pressed into service at times. The four which weren\u2019t refurbished were <strong>4001<\/strong>, <strong>4002<\/strong>, <strong>4040<\/strong> and <strong>4083<\/strong> with <strong>4040<\/strong> recently seen back in service for the first time in 2019.<\/p>\n<p><!--more-->Coupled with fellow unrefurbished train <strong>4083<\/strong> (they can only run amongst themselves), <strong>4040<\/strong> was running on peak time extras on 18th September. As for <strong>4083<\/strong> this is the only Metro Car not to carry fleet livery with a long-standing advert for Emirates Airline instead being carried. The two prototype vehicles <strong>4001<\/strong> and <strong>4002<\/strong> have also not been seen for a while with the former last noted in May and <strong>4002<\/strong> in April.<\/p>\n<div id=\"attachment_30007\" style=\"width: 560px\" class=\"wp-caption aligncenter\"><a href=\"http:\/\/www.britishtramsonline.co.uk\/news\/?attachment_id=30007\" rel=\"attachment wp-att-30007\"><img aria-describedby=\"caption-attachment-30007\" loading=\"lazy\" class=\"size-medium wp-image-30007\" title=\"4083-th\" src=\"http:\/\/www.britishtramsonline.co.uk\/news\/wp-content\/uploads\/2019\/09\/4083-th-550x366.jpg\" alt=\"\" width=\"550\" height=\"366\" srcset=\"https:\/\/www.britishtramsonline.co.uk\/news\/wp-content\/uploads\/2019\/09\/4083-th-550x366.jpg 550w, https:\/\/www.britishtramsonline.co.uk\/news\/wp-content\/uploads\/2019\/09\/4083-th-1024x682.jpg 1024w, https:\/\/www.britishtramsonline.co.uk\/news\/wp-content\/uploads\/2019\/09\/4083-th.jpg 1275w\" sizes=\"(max-width: 550px) 100vw, 550px\" \/><\/a><p id=\"caption-attachment-30007\" class=\"wp-caption-text\">4083 in Emirates livery with 4040 at Pelaw with a peak time extra which terminates here.
